Skip to main content
Beijing 2022 Winter Games
News
Galleries
Medals
Schedule
Home
News
Sports
Obituaries
Opinion
Calendar
Features
Entertainment
Search
Search
Awwad Alawwad
Saudi Arabia ends death penalty for minors and floggings
By Aya Batrawy Apr. 26, 2020 01:17 PM EDT